CARE EXCELLENCE AND THE STRATEGIC ROLE OF THE HEALTHCARE TEAM IN CONTINUOUS IMPROVEMENT
Abstract
This review article explores the intersection between hospital accreditation, quality management, and patient safety, focusing on the role of the nursing team. Based on an analysis of selected scientific articles, the article seeks to understand the contributions, challenges, and strategies adopted by healthcare institutions and professionals to achieve and maintain standards of excellence in care. The benefits of accreditation for quality of care, patient safety, professional development, and process optimization will be addressed, as well as the obstacles faced, such as resistance to change and resource management. The importance of nurses as central agents in this process will be highlighted, highlighting their role in leadership, training, and continuous monitoring of quality initiatives.
